Wprowadzenie do pojęcia „log”
Definicja
Log to fundamentalne pojęcie w informatyce i systemach informatycznych.
Jest to zapis zdarzeń lub operacji, które wystąpiły w określonym czasie w systemie komputerowym, sieci, aplikacji lub oprogramowaniu.
Struktura logu
Logi są zazwyczaj strukturyzowane w formie tekstowej lub binarnej. Składają się z wpisów, z których każdy zawiera informacje o zdarzeniu, takie jak data, godzina, rodzaj zdarzenia, identyfikator użytkownika itp. W niektórych przypadkach logi mogą być również bogatsze w treść, zawierając szczegółowe informacje na temat działania systemu lub aplikacji.
Rola logów w systemach informatycznych
Logi odgrywają kluczową rolę w monitorowaniu, diagnostyce i analizie systemów informatycznych. Służą do śledzenia aktywności użytkowników, identyfikowania problemów, wykrywania błędów oraz audytu bezpieczeństwa. Bez logów byłoby trudno zrozumieć, co się dzieje w systemie w danym czasie oraz znaleźć przyczyny problemów czy ataków.
Rodzaje logów
Istnieje wiele rodzajów logów, z których każdy służy innemu celowi. Oto kilka popularnych rodzajów logów:
Logi zdarzeń systemowych: Rejestr zdarzeń w systemach operacyjnych Windows lub dziennik systemowy w systemach Unix/Linux.
Logi aplikacji: Zapisują informacje o działaniu konkretnej aplikacji, takie jak błędy, ostrzeżenia, informacje diagnostyczne.
Logi bezpieczeństwa: Służą do monitorowania prób dostępu, ataków lub podejrzanej aktywności w systemie.
Logi sieciowe: Rejestrują ruch sieciowy, zdarzenia związane z siecią, takie jak połączenia, próby ataków itp.
Logi serwera: Rejestracja działalności serwera, takiej jak żądania HTTP, błędy aplikacji, dostęp do zasobów itp.
Przechowywanie i analiza logów
Logi są zazwyczaj przechowywane w plikach lub bazach danych, a ich analiza może być wykonywana ręcznie przez administratorów systemów lub za pomocą narzędzi do zarządzania logami oraz systemów monitorowania. Analiza logów może pomóc w identyfikacji wzorców zachowań, wykrywaniu ataków, optymalizacji działania systemu oraz spełnianiu wymagań regulacyjnych.
Ważność logów dla bezpieczeństwa
W kontekście bezpieczeństwa logi są niezwykle ważne, ponieważ umożliwiają śledzenie działań niepożądanych, ataków czy naruszeń bezpieczeństwa. Dzięki logom administratorzy mogą szybko reagować na incydenty, ograniczając szkody i minimalizując ryzyko dla organizacji.
Logi stanowią nieodłączny element każdego systemu informatycznego, umożliwiając śledzenie zdarzeń, diagnostykę problemów, analizę działania oraz monitorowanie bezpieczeństwa. Ich właściwe przechowywanie, analiza i interpretacja są kluczowe dla zapewnienia wydajności, niezawodności i bezpieczeństwa systemów informatycznych.